T7 Global’s facility begins gas production


KUALA LUMPUR: T7 Global Bhd’s wholly-owned subsidiary Tanjung Offshore Services Sdn Bhd has announced the commencement of gas production by the TSeven Elise mobile offshore production unit (Mopu) at the Bayan field.

In a statement, the integrated solutions provider said the event marked the official start of revenue contribution by TSeven Elise Mopu, which would provide a fixed and recurring income base for T7 Global Group over the next 10 years.

“T7 Global remains steadfast in its commitment to optimise Mopu operations, ensuring uninterrupted production uptime while prioritising environmental protection. The commencement of the production phase at the Bayan field will ensure a stable supply to the gas market,” said T7 Global chief executive officer Tan Kay Zhuin.

Located in sub-block 4Q-21 of the Balingian Province, 80km North-West of Bintulu Malaysia LNG, and operating at a water depth of around 30m, the TSeven Elise Mopu is a newly built Mopu designed for the Bayan redevelopment project gas phase two.

According to the group, the advanced facility boasts cutting-edge gas compression systems with the capacity to process and export up to 100 million standard cubic feet per day to the Bintulu Malaysia LNG facility.
